New Autopsy Tech Struggling with Organ Removal Flow — Looking for Advice by Meister_Ashes0403 in AutopsyTechFam

[–]Additional-Pool3178 2 points3 points  (0 children)

hi ! how long have you been working as an autopsy tech ? a lot of what you mentioned i also went through my first month or so. what really helped me was having an order on how to remove things.

heart/lung -> liver -> spleen -> stomach/pancreas (the drs i work with prefer both be taken out together — this helps me a lot!) -> adrenals -> kidneys -> small/large intestine -> aorta -> bladder/prostate/uterus

what i found helpful was moving around to different sides of the table. it helps me orient myself and gets me in a comfortable enough position where i can get more exposure to the organ i am looking at. for example i used to take out the liver standing on the right side of the body. i took way too long doing this. once i moved to the left side i was able to see more of the liver and more of where i needed to cut.

as for the pancreas, i take out stomach with it as well. what really helps me is the texture and firmness of the pancreas. once i feel a harder, firmer part, i know my hands are on the pancreas. i follow it until i feel the head of it (duodenum area) just so i know where to cut off. i gently pull the stomach and tail of pancreas towards me cut off at the duodenum area. ill pull the pancreas and stomach out together. i clamp the small intestine so it doesn’t get all nasty. by gently pulling you will be able to see the tension you create and know that you are good to make cuts through there (i really hope this makes sense).

also, you can usually stick your finger through the fat between the large intestine and stomach. once you get through/remove this fat, the pancreas is right below that. you can start feeling around and hopefully you feel its firmness!!

im also happy to help if you have any more questions !

High schooler interested in becoming a morgue/autopsy technician- seeking guidance on how to get started by Flat-Ad2744 in AutopsyTechFam

[–]Additional-Pool3178 2 points3 points  (0 children)

hi! i would ask to shadow a pathologist to first observe and see if it’s something you’d like to do. sometimes there are private pathologists that have their own practice instead of working for county or a hospital.

most of what you learn will be on the job to be honest. but having a basic understanding of anatomy is very important!
